8.3.2 DLC Establishment

The multiplexer control channel must be set up as the first channel followed by all other DLCIs. To do
so, a SABM frame (see Section 8.2.3) must be sent to the TC3x. The TC3x responds with either a UA
frame – i.e., the DLCI was set up, or with a DM frame if the DLCI was not set up.
No provision is made for repeating the request if a response is not received.
The state machine requesting the multiplexer control channel DLCI = 0 is the "initiating station", while
the other is called the "responding station".

8.3.3 Information transfer

A response is not essential for every command – for example, unsolicited code does not require a
response.
